PH to host U-19 Asian Sepaktakraw Championship 2026

THE  Philippines has officially been awarded the hosting rights for the ASTAF U-19 Asian Sepaktakraw Championship 2026, following the signing of a Letter of Agreement between the Asian Sepaktakraw Federation (ASTAF) and the Philippines Sepaktakraw Association Inc (PASTAI).

The agreement was finalized after formal meetings held in Thailand  last December 17,  2025 and formally dated  December 18  2025, granting PASTAI the mandate to organize and stage the continental youth championship in Manila, Philippines, scheduled for November 2026.

Under the agreement, ASTAF officially authorizes PASTAI to host the tournament in full compliance with the ISTAF 2023–2025 Tournament Hosting Requirements, including adherence to international technical standards, competition formats, and governance protocols.

The championship will be officiated by International Technical Officials (ITOs) and match officials appointed by the International Sepaktakraw Federation (ISTAF).

The Letter of Agreement also outlines the host association’s responsibilities covering local event delivery, venue preparation, logistics, security, athlete services, media facilities, transportation, accommodation, tournament promotion, and technical operations, as detailed in the official annexes accompanying the agreement.

Marketing, commercial, and broadcasting rights for the championship remain vested with ISTAF, reinforcing the event’s international positioning and ensuring global visibility for one of Asia’s premier youths Sepaktakraw competitions.
